Sage Springs Group Campground Introduce

For local users seeking "camping near me" that offers a tranquil retreat amidst stunning natural beauty, Sage Springs Group Campground, located at 7031 Eastshore Rd, St Charles, ID 83272, USA, presents an intriguing option. Situated on the shores of the renowned Bear Lake, often referred to as the "Caribbean of the West" due to its surreal turquoise waters, this campground appears to emphasize a peaceful and less crowded camping experience, particularly appealing to groups looking for a serene getaway.

The environment surrounding Sage Springs Group Campground is consistently lauded for its exceptional beauty. Even those just passing through are captivated by "the beauty of the lake," describing it as "surreal" with colors and wave sounds reminiscent of the Caribbean Sea. This vivid description underscores the visual appeal of Bear Lake, which is the primary environmental feature influencing the campground's atmosphere. The designation as the "Caribbean of the West" sets high expectations for the lake's appearance and the overall scenic quality of the area. One reviewer who visited in June 2023 described the location as a "Beautiful and calm place," further emphasizing the tranquility of this particular side of Bear Lake. The observation that "not many people come to this side of the Bear Lake" suggests a more secluded and peaceful environment compared to potentially more popular areas of the lake, making it an attractive destination for those seeking respite from crowds and noise. The invitation to "just enjoy the peace" encapsulates the essence of the environment surrounding Sage Springs Group Campground.
